Indent

usgb/ɪnˈdent/
verb

To make a space at the beginning of a line of writing.

Don't forget to indent each new paragraph when you write your essay.

LampPro Tip 1/3

Essay Structure

Indenting signals the start of a new paragraph, organizing thoughts in essays.

Illustration for Essay Structure
Remember to indent after the introduction.
LampPro Tip 2/3

Visual Clarity

An indent helps readers distinguish between separate ideas or steps.

Illustration for Visual Clarity
Each instruction was indented, making the manual easy to follow.
LampPro Tip 3/3

Block Quotes

In academic writing, longer quotes are indented to set them apart.

Illustration for Block Quotes
The excerpt was indented because it exceeded four lines.
